Output 159b5c3ab641a1c6284c16e5279b0256535571b3eff037c8f4ca27910124722b:0

value
27831
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3770fb9723a51108a853d69588041fafdd465 OP_EQUAL
address
3BMEXwGikYGaVcuvJe7bvZWPPjY3HwRbq7
transaction
159b5c3ab641a1c6284c16e5279b0256535571b3eff037c8f4ca27910124722b